Embark on a rewarding career journey as a Customer Team Member at Co-op, a role that offers more than just a job – it's an opportunity to become part of a community-focused organization with a strong commitment to its people.

This permanent, part-time position, based at Burford Road, Harebushes, Cirencester, GL7 5DS, offers a competitive pay rate of £12.60 per hour, with the added advantage of regular overtime opportunities. The working pattern involves two weekend shifts per week, encompassing early mornings (store opening) and afternoons. While the exact schedule will be discussed at the interview, this provides a structured yet flexible framework for your work week.

Key Advantages for Potential Candidates:

  • Exceptional Benefits Package: Co-op stands out with an impressive array of benefits. Enjoy a generous 31 days of holiday (pro rata for part-time colleagues), a comprehensive pension scheme with up to 10% employer contributions, and access to vital virtual healthcare services for you and your family, including GP appointments, mental health support, and more.
  • Generous Employee Discount: A significant perk is the 30% discount on all Co-op products purchased in-store, along with 10% discounts on other brands. This offers substantial savings on everyday essentials and more.
  • Focus on Wellbeing and Development: Co-op prioritizes your wellbeing, offering support for your physical, mental, and financial health. They provide market-leading policies to assist with significant life events, demonstrating a genuine commitment to their colleagues' lives beyond work. Furthermore, full, paid training is provided, alongside dedicated support for your personal development and career progression.
  • Financial Flexibility: The inclusion of Wagestream, a money management app, allows you to access a percentage of your earned pay before payday, offering valuable financial flexibility.
  • Work-Life Balance Support: With rotas shared three weeks in advance and accessible via your mobile device, Co-op facilitates better planning and management of your personal life.
  • Commitment to Inclusivity: Co-op is dedicated to building diverse and inclusive teams. They welcome applications from all backgrounds and are committed to making reasonable adjustments throughout the recruitment process for candidates with disabilities, including guaranteed interviews for those meeting minimum criteria through the Disability Confident scheme.
